Output efb81d57d073bb1e6a2bb7338d5ff9a1b39cfef2175d9945fc022484cb702e8f:0

value
399618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ed31c800a66c4fa7bbd3c0bc701c9fb2ced0bd OP_EQUAL
address
3MC9zxqUSNXShXGbUx1pDhUnpYh8rwfSZS
transaction
efb81d57d073bb1e6a2bb7338d5ff9a1b39cfef2175d9945fc022484cb702e8f
spent
true